Also known as: Arvedui Last-King
The last king of Arthedain, whose very name — given in foresight at his birth — means "last king." He claimed the crown of Gondor when its southern line failed, by right of descent from Isildur and his marriage to Firiel, daughter of King Ondoher; Gondor refused him, a decision with a thousand years of consequences. When the Witch-king overwhelmed Arthedain in 1974, Arvedui fled north to the ice-bay of Forochel, where the Snowmen of the Lossoth sheltered him against their own misgivings. He took ship despite their warning of the weather; the ship was crushed in the ice, and with him drowned the palantiri of Annuminas and Amon Sul. Yet his line endured through his son Aranarth, first Chieftain of the Dunedain, down to Aragorn — who made good both claims at last.
